I'm student in Thailand.Majority tourist has come to Thailand and taste many Thai type food. Thai majority food has spicy smack such as : spicy lemongrass shrimp soup, But the food that me will mention at this time be "green papaya salad". the way does to are , lead the papaya come to penetrate in a mortar with tomato , groundnut , dried shrimp , chili , garlic , bucket sugar , fish sauce , a crab is pickling , pickled fish.
in now green papaya salad is the food extensively and like to eat every a part of Thailand, and still Thai famous food builds a cosmopolite as well.
